Overview of Crime in Clayhall

The total recorded crimes in Clayhall, Redbridge, UK in March 2025 are around 80 as per the recent police data. This equates to a Clayhall crime rate of 1.71 per 1,000 population.

It's important to note that this crime data is based on the Geographic Boundry data provided by the ONS around Clayhall, encompassing approximately 46,717 residents.

How safe is Clayhall?

To understand the safety of Clayhall, we need to analyze Clayhall crime statistics in relation to regional averages. Lets examine the available data and provide a balanced assessment.

  • Relative to Redbridge:

    • In 2024, Clayhall demonstrated a lower crime volume than the Redbridge average, with 570 crimes compared to 758.0. This suggests a relatively safer position within the region for the year. Additionally, Clayhall recorded fewer crimes than 14 out of 21 other cities.

    • In 2023, Clayhall had fewer crimes than the Redbridge average, with 1,067 crimes compared to 1,360. This reflects a relatively lower crime rate for the area within the region that year. Additionally, Clayhall recorded fewer crimes than 14 out of 21 other cities.

  • Overall Assessment:

    • Compared to other areas in Redbridge, Clayhall has a lower crime rate and is considered safer in 2024.

    • The trend in crime rates suggests Positive changes in overall safety.
